tools_data_cleanup.php

来自「GForge 3.0 协作开发平台 支持CVS, mailing lists, 」· PHP 代码 · 共 44 行

PHP
44
字号
<?php/* *  Due to bug in code, patch and support req close date wasn't *  set properly before 2000-11-16. This script is to fix it (kinda). * */require ('squal_pre.php');if (!strstr($REMOTE_ADDR,$sys_internal_network)) {        exit_permission_denied();}echo "Patching patches<br />";# If some patch is not opened, set its close date one month after open$res=db_query("UPDATE patchSET close_date=open_date+60*60*24*30WHERE close_date=0 AND patch_status_id NOT IN (0,1)");if (!$res) print "error<br />";echo "Affected rows: ",db_affected_rows($res),"<br /><br />";echo "Patching sup reqs<br />";$res=db_query("UPDATE supportSET close_date=open_date+60*60*24*30WHERE close_date=0 AND support_status_id NOT IN (0,1)");if (!$res) print "error<br />";echo "Affected rows: ",db_affected_rows($res),"<br /><br />";?>

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?